We hold a meeting on the second Monday of each month at Number 6 from 7.30 to 9.15pm. Number 6 is the Edinburgh office of Autism Initiatives UK. It is located at 6 Melville Crescent in Edinburgh's west end see map


About six to ten adults with AS come to the meeting. The group may also include people who think they may have AS, partners or friends of adults with AS, and often, by prior arrangement, health, social workers or other professionals. The meeting normally follows an agenda. This would be sent out to all members prior to the meeting. News in the AS and autism scene will be covered, the group will look at arranging the next social event and various topics of interest will be discussed.

How to find Number 6

From Waverley and Princes Street: walk towards the West End past Fraser's Department Store at the end of Princes Street. Turn right onto Queensferry Street. Take the third on the left, which is Melville Street. Carry along Melville Street until you see the statue in the centre of the road. The surrounding buildings are Melville Crescent.

From Haymarket Station: walk towards Princes Street, along West Maitland Street and take the second street on the left (Manor Place). Take the second on the right which into Melville Street until you see a statue in the centre of the road. The surrounding buildings are Melville Crescent.
